contourf
Trace de contours remplis d'une matrice
📝Syntaxe
contourf(Z)
contourf(X, Y, Z)
contourf(..., levels)
contourf(..., LineSpec)
contourf(ax, ...)
M = contourf(...)
[M, h] = contourf(...)
📥Arguments d'entrée
Paramètre Description
X Coordonnees x : vecteur ou matrice.
Y Coordonnees y : vecteur ou matrice.
Z Coordonnees z : matrice numerique.
levels Niveaux de contours : nombre de niveaux, vecteur de niveaux ou [k k] pour un seul niveau.
LineSpec Style et couleur de ligne.
ax Axes parent.
📤Arguments de sortie
Paramètre Description
M Matrice de contours.
h Objet graphique de type contour.
📄Description

contourf trace des bandes de contours remplies pour les valeurs de Z. La matrice retournee correspond a la propriete ContourMatrix de l'objet.

L'objet contour prend en charge les proprietes de ligne, de remplissage, de transparence, d'etiquetage et de niveaux, notamment FaceColor, FaceAlpha, ShowText, LabelColor, LabelSpacing, LabelFormat, TextList, TextStep et ZLocation.

💡Exemples
Tracer des contours remplis.
figure();
[X,Y,Z] = peaks(40);
[M,h] = contourf(X,Y,Z,10);
h.FaceAlpha = 0.75;
Tracer des contours remplis.
x = linspace(-2*pi, 2*pi, 100);
y = linspace(-2*pi, 2*pi, 100);
[X, Y] = meshgrid(x, y);
Z = sin(X) .* cos(Y);
figure;
contourf(X, Y, Z, 20);
colorbar;
title('Demo contourf');
xlabel('X');
ylabel('Y');
colormap parula;
Example illustration
🔗Voir aussi
contourcontourccontour3clabel
🕔Historique des versions
Version Description
1.17.0 version initiale
Modifier cette page sur GitHub